Take urgent action to combat climate change and its impacts
There is no country that is not experiencing the drastic effects of climate change. Global warming is causing long-lasting changes to our climate system, which threatens irreversible consequences if we do not act.

As of 2017 humans are estimated to have caused approximately 1.0°C of global warming above pre-industrial levels
To limit warming to 1.5C, global net CO2 emissions must reach net zero around 2050
Sea levels have risen by about 20 cm (8 inches) since 1880

Climate pledges under The Paris Agreement cover only one third of the emissions reductions needed to keep the world below 2°C
Bold climate action could trigger at least $26 trillion in economic benefits by 2030
The energy sector alone will create around 18 million more jobs by 2030
